When shopping for yacht insurance, it's essential to understand what's covered under your policy. Typically, this includes damage or loss due to theft, fire, collision, and other perils. Some policies may also offer additional coverage options such as liability protection, medical payments, and personal effects coverage.
It's crucial to carefully review the terms and conditions of your policy to ensure that you're adequately protected in the event of an unexpected incident.
Choosing the right yacht insurance policy can be a daunting task, especially with so many options available. When selecting a policy, consider factors such as coverage limits, deductibles, and premium costs. It's also essential to research the insurer's reputation, financial stability, and claims processing procedures.
